1. Understanding the Average Lifespan of a Poodle

Poodles come in three sizes: standard, miniature, and toy. Each size has its own unique characteristics, including their expected lifespan. Generally, poodles can live anywhere from 12 to 15 years, with smaller varieties often living longer than their larger counterparts. For instance, toy poodles can live up to 18 years, making them a long-term commitment for any pet owner.

But what factors contribute to this impressive longevity? Genetics play a significant role, as does proper care and attention. Regular vet check-ups, a balanced diet, and plenty of exercise are key to ensuring your poodle enjoys a healthy, vibrant life. Plus, poodles are known for their high energy levels, which means they need regular walks and playtime to stay happy and healthy. 🏞️🐾

2. Health Considerations for Your Poodle

While poodles are generally a healthy breed, they are not immune to certain health issues. Common conditions include hip dysplasia, progressive retinal atrophy, and Addison’s disease. Regular vet visits can help catch these issues early, giving you the best chance to manage them effectively.

Additionally, poodles are prone to ear infections due to their floppy ears, which can trap moisture and bacteria. Regular cleaning and inspection can prevent these pesky problems. And don’t forget those beautiful coats! Regular grooming is essential to keep them free from mats and tangles, ensuring your poodle looks as good as they feel. 🧼✨

3. Tips for Extending Your Poodle’s Life

To ensure your poodle lives a long and healthy life, there are several things you can do:

  • Maintain a Healthy Diet: High-quality dog food that meets all nutritional needs is crucial. Avoid overfeeding to prevent obesity, which can lead to a host of health issues.
  • Regular Exercise: Poodles need daily physical activity to stay fit and mentally stimulated. This could be walks, playtime in the park, or interactive games at home.
  • Vaccinations and Preventive Care: Keep up with vaccinations and preventive treatments for fleas, ticks, and heartworms to protect against common parasites and diseases.
  • Love and Attention: Emotional well-being is just as important as physical health. Spend quality time with your poodle, providing love, affection, and mental stimulation through training and socialization.

By following these tips, you can help your poodle live a long, healthy, and happy life. Remember, every poodle is unique, so tailor their care to meet their specific needs.
